Not Mounting Your Dishwasher Correctly Can Result In a Mountain of Problems
Not just can mounting a dishwashing machine properly invalidate your guarantee, but it can additionally develop a mess. If you do not mount the supply line correctly, you could deal with leaks-- or also worse, a flooding. You might also exper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s also rapidly via your pipes and triggers loud shaking noises. If you inaccurately install your dishwasher to the trash disposal, you may observe pungent smells or have residue on your meals.

A Plumber Can Evaluate the Supply Lines
A supply line, specifically a dish washer connector, connects the dishwasher to a water source. A plumber can make sure that the line is suitable with both your dish washer as well as water source if you buy a brand-new supply line. If you determine to make use of an existing supply line, a professional plumber can inspect it to make certain that it remains in good condition as well as does not have any leakages.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ION
If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.
If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.
